TITLE:

RANDOMIZED MEASURED EXPERIMENTAL RESEARCH TO ASSOCIATE BELONGINGS OF NICARDIPINE IN ADDITION PROSTAGLANDIN E1 PERSUADED HYPOTENSION ON ARTERIAL OXYGEN COMPRESSION

AUTHORS:

Dr Aneeza Saleem, Dr Yusra Iqbal, Tahreem Asim

ABSTRACT:

Objective: Major oxygen pressure might lessen at encouraged hypotension throughout overall anesthesia through nicardipine or else prostaglandin E1. The current research remained achieved to associate belongings of nicardipine in addition PG on PaO2 throughout encouraged hypotension in over-all anesthesia. Methodology: Our existing research was randomized measured non-blind research which remained led at current operation theater of Sir Ganga Ram Hospital from October 2016 to March 2017. Sixty respondents aged 41 to 66 years for resection of brain cancer remained registered in our current study. Throughout over-all anesthesia through isoflurane, nitrous oxide in addition fentanyl, as soon as hemodynamics remained steady, PG 0.06 μg/kg/ minutes, or else 0.2 μg/kg/minutes, else nicardipine 0.6 μg/kg/minutes, or else 2.1 μg/kg/minutes remained managed for three hours in 11 respondents apiece. Additional 11 respondents remained set aside as regulator. Major blood pressure, heart proportion, SpO2, culmination-tidal carbon dioxide heaviness, also major oxygen also PaCO2 compressions remained restrained till 1.5 hrs. afterwards rest of supervision of PG else nicardipine. Proportion of PaO2 also oxygen portion remained designed. Results. Together PG also nicardipine reduced BP likewise through upsurge in HR. P/F proportion reduced solitary through PG. Conclusion. Usage of prostaglandin E1 to encourage hypotension throughout overall anesthesia remains related concluded the reduced PaO2, whereas nicardipine has not any consequence. This alteration in consequence on PaO2 remains significant in choosing a go-between to persuade hypotension in neurosurgery. Key words: Hypotension, Nicardipine, Prostaglandin E1, Arterial oxygen pressure.
